The Ground mount PV systems 2P-10, Concrete Pier is optimized for standard modules with dimensions of 2278 × 1134 × 30 mm. This is one of the most common formats in the PV industry. . Use Concrete Pier Blocks with Metal Brackets. Know the unique aspects of. . Capacity 20 photovoltaic panels Compatible panel size 2278 × 1134 × 30 mm Foundation system Galvanized steel posts anchored in isolated concrete piers, 1000 mm depth Tilt angles 20°, 23°, 25°, 28°, 30° (other variants available on request) Compatible Photovoltaic Panels The Ground mount PV systems. . Most residential solar modules today fall within the range of 250 to 400 watts each, meaning a 300-watt unit can produce approximately 300 watts of electricity during peak sunlight hours. A 400-watt panel can generate 400 watts per hour under the same conditions. This doesn't mean they'll produce that amount all day, output varies with weather, shade, and panel orientation.
